For the Canes, Rod Brind'Amour is going to have to make a choice of goalies in the playoffs and how much he might use vet Frederik Andersen could well come down to how well Freddy fares tonight vs. the Sens. After missing considerable time the first half of the season, and not working consecutive games since last year's playoffs, Brind'Amour might instead be opting for Pyotr Kochetkov in the playoffs. Andersen has lost his last three starts while stopping just 62 of 75 shots (subpar .827 saves). Meanwhile, Anton Forsberg (.856 saves last three) also struggling in goal lately for Ottawa, though the Sens' offense has scored 12 goals the last three as they prepare to face Toronto in the first round.
